         <title>The Law of Conservation of Mass</title>
         <author>brownh_22</author>
         <link>https://padlet.com/brownh_22/wa9nx78goc7r/wish/417594329</link>
         <description><![CDATA[<div>What<em> Does The Law State?</em><br>In every physical change and chemical reaction, mass is conserved. Mass can neither be CREATED nor DESTROYED.<br><em>———————————————<br>How Will This Apply To The Growth</em> <em>Of</em> <em>A</em> <em>Tree</em>?<br>When a tree grows it increases its mass, not by gaining more atoms but by rearranging atoms the tree already possesses. Even though the mass of a tree gradually increases, the total mass of the tree plus the mass of the trees surroundings will always remain at a constant mass.</div>]]></description>

         <title>Photosynthesis</title>
         <author>brownh_22</author>
         <link>https://padlet.com/brownh_22/wa9nx78goc7r/wish/417814792</link>
         <description><![CDATA[<div><em>What is Photosynthesis?<br></em>Photosynthesis is a process in which green plants and algae use radiant energy from the sun to synthesize glucose from carbon dioxide and water. It uses the suns energy to reduce the Carbon Dioxide into  compounds that have C—H bonds.</div><div>———————————————<br><em>What is the equation for Photosynthesis?</em></div><div>6CO<sub>2 </sub>  +   6H<sub>2</sub>O   +   Energy   ———&gt;   C<sub>6</sub>H<sub>12</sub>O<sub>6</sub>   +   6O<sub>2<br>Carbon          Water              from                           Glucose           Oxygen<br></sub><sup>Dioxide                                Sunlight</sup></div><div>———————————————<br><em>What are the steps of photosynthesis?</em><br>1. CO2 and H2O enter the leaf.<br>2. Light hits the pigmentations in the membrane of a thylakoid, which causes the H2O to split into O2.<br>3. The electrons shift down into the enzymes.<br>4. Sunlight hits the second pigmentation molecule enabling the enzymes to transform the ADP into ATP and the NADP+ into NADPH.<br>5. The Calvin Cycle takes the ATP and NADPH to use as the power source for converting Carbon Dioxide in the atmosphere into Glucose(Sugar).</div>]]></description>
